Introduction:
Internet poker features transformed the gambling business, offering people with the convenience of playing a common card online game from the absolute comfort of their domiciles. This report aims to explore the development, popularity, and influence of online poker. By delving in to the history, benefits, and challenges experienced by online poker platforms, we can gain a comprehensive understanding of this flourishing business.

Record and Growth:
Online poker appeared within the belated 1990s as a result of advancements in technology as well as the internet. 1st online poker space, earth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a little but passionate neighborhood. But was in the first 2000s that on-line poker experienced exponential growth, mostly as a result of introduction of real-money highstakes games and televised poker tournaments.

Recognition and Accessibility:
One of the most significant grounds for the enormous interest in online poker is its availability. People can get on their most favorite on-line poker platforms whenever you want, from everywhere, utilizing their computer systems or mobile devices. This convenience has actually drawn a varied player base, which range from recreational players to experts, causing the quick expansion of internet poker.

Advantages of Online Poker:
On-line poker provides a few advantages over standard br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it provides a wider number of online game choices, including different poker alternatives and stakes, catering to the preferences and budgets of forms of people. In addition, on-line poker areas are available 24/7, eliminating the limitations of actual casino running hours. Additionally, on line systems frequently offer appealing incentives, respect programs, additionally the power to play numerous tables at the same time, improving the overall gaming experience.

Challenges and Regulation:
Even though the internet poker business thrives, it faces challenges in the shape of legislation and security problems. Governing bodies worldwide have implemented differing examples of legislation to safeguard players and give a wide berth to fraudulent tasks. Additionally, online poker platforms require powerful security actions to guard players' personal and economic information, ensuring a secure playing environment.

The growth of online poker has already established a substantial financial impact globally. Internet poker systems create substantial revenue through rake costs, tournament entry fees, and marketing and advertising. This income features resulted in work creation and opportunities when you look at the gaming business. Furthermore, online poker has actually contributed to a rise in tax revenue for governing bodies where it is regulated, promoting community solutions.

From a social perspective, on-line poker features fostered an international poker community, bridging geographical barriers. People from diverse backgrounds and places can connect and contend, fostering a sense of camaraderie. On-line poker has additionally played a vital role to promote the video game's popularity and attracting new players, ultimately causing the development of the poker industry overall.

Summary:
In summary, on-line poker is becoming an international phenomenon, supplying people with unparalleled convenience and an array of video gaming choices. The development of on-line poker has been fueled by its availability, advantages over old-fashioned gambling enterprises, and also the economic and personal impact this has produced. However, difficulties in regulation and safety should be dealt with to ensure the continued success and durability regarding the industry. As technology evolves, on-line poker probably will carry on its ascending trajectory, solidifying its position as a dynamic and interesting kind of enjoyment.
